Hi! My name is Mathilde!

I’ve been lucky enough to participate in AMA three times. AMA stands for ‘artistic missionary year’. It’s not just a show, it’s a commitment and a real life experience. I like to say that what I love about AMA is that we share everything with the other members of the troupe. We dance together, we create together, we eat together, we sweat together, we share together, we pray together… we live everything together, and that allows us to create a super close-knit fraternity, which is really important when you have an artistic project like this together. It changes everything in the show. What I also really appreciated was feeling truly welcomed for who I was, with the talents I had (or didn’t have). I had never danced ‘seriously’ before participating in AMA, and I found a real kindness there, where everyone helped and received help. It allowed me to discover and develop the talent I had within me! Everyone has something to contribute.

It is also a real blessing to be able to share an artistic experience with other Christians. The dimension of prayer is very present, and this is a real bonus when it comes to putting together our show, finding inspiration, giving each other strength and, above all, giving meaning to what we do.

Being able to entrust each warm-up to prayer really changes the meaning we give to what we are building. Being able to share the graces and difficulties with others in the troupe really helps us to move forward and to make the Lord present in every detail. When we take a step back and entrust everything to him, we finally see that God is the true artistic director behind it all.

We are offering this show for the opening of the festival and to share our joy with others. What makes me happy is that the goal is not to put on THE performance, but simply to SHARE with others.
